Desmond Heyliger, Jr., June 12, 1928~November 16, 2018

Nov 17, 2018

Desmond Heyliger, Jr., 90, of Fayetteville, passed away on November 16, 2018 at home under the care of Circle of Life Hospice.

Memorial services will be held 11:00 am November 20, 2018 at Mount Comfort Presbyterian Church with the Rev. Dan Wooley of Mount Comfort Presbyterian Church, officiating.  Reception to follow at the Old School House. Military burial at the Fayetteville National Cemetery.

Desmond was born in Germantown, Pennsylvania to Desmond, Sr and Marjorie (Molt) Heyliger on June 12, 1928.   He married Barbara J. Bowen on November 15, 1952 in Willow Grove, Pennsylvania the day after he was discharged from the Army.  He attended Temple University in Philadelphia.  He went into business as a custom building contractor from 1962 through 1974 then retired and moved to Fayetteville, Arkansas where he enjoyed his retirement fishing and farming. He was a veteran of the Korean War from 1950 through 1952 and served in the Army, where he earned the nickname “Moose” Heyliger.

Desmond is preceded in death by his parents; daughter, Debra Heyliger Lankford; and son, Robert Bruce Heyliger.

Desmond is survived by his wife of 66 years, Barbara Joan Bowen Heyliger; children, Desmond Heyliger III (Barbara A.), Dorothy Heyliger Ashworth (Billy D.) and Marjorie Heyliger Ward (Daniel); sisters, Joyce Heyliger Striegler and Nancy Heyliger Thwaites; 13 grandchildren and 13 great-grandchildren.
